Crispy Herb-Crusted Catfish with Lemon Garlic Sauce
Enjoy a delicate, crispy herb-crusted catfish paired with a vibrant lemon garlic sauce and a side of steamed broccoli. The dish offers a satisfying crunch from whole wheat breadcrumbs combined with aromatic herbs, offset by the tangy, fresh lemon and savory garlic. A balanced meal perfect for a light dinner that's both flavorful and nutritious.
INGREDIENTS
6 oz Catfish Fillet
2 tbsp Whole Wheat Breadcrumbs
2 tbsp Fresh Parsley (chopped)
1 tsp Dried Thyme
1 tsp Dried Oregano
Salt & Black Pepper to taste
1 tbsp Lemon Juice
1 clove Garlic, minced
1 tsp Olive Oil
1 cup Steamed Broccoli
PREPARATION
Preheat the oven to 425°F (220°C).
Pat the catfish fillets dry and season lightly with salt and black pepper.
In a shallow dish, combine whole wheat breadcrumbs, chopped fresh parsley, dried thyme, and dried oregano.
Press each catfish fillet into the breadcrumb mixture ensuring an even coating on both sides.
Place the coated fillets on a lightly greased baking sheet.
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until the fish flakes easily with a fork and the crust is crispy.
While the catfish bakes, prepare the lemon garlic sauce by combining lemon juice, minced garlic, and olive oil in a small bowl.
Remove the fish from the oven and drizzle the lemon garlic sauce evenly over the fillets.
Serve the crispy herb-crusted catfish immediately with a side of steamed broccoli.
